Why bills stay high even without obvious waste

Most utility overspending comes from small, persistent inefficiencies rather than one dramatic cause. A dripping faucet wastes thousands of gallons per year. A water heater set 20 degrees too high adds cost every single day. Gaps around door frames let conditioned air escape around the clock. None of these require a contractor to fix, and collectively they can account for a substantial share of monthly costs.

Step-by-step: changes that lower electricity, gas, and water costs

Work through these steps in order or pick the ones that apply most directly to your home. Each stands on its own.

1

Adjust your water heater temperature

Most water heaters ship from the factory set to 140 degrees Fahrenheit. The U.S. Department of Energy recommends 120 degrees for most households, which is sufficient for sanitation and reduces standby heat loss. Locate the thermostat dial on your water heater tank and turn it down to 120. Allow 24 hours for the tank temperature to stabilize before testing at a tap.

Tip: If your water heater is more than 10 years old, check its energy factor rating. An aging unit may be costing significantly more to operate than a newer equivalent, even at a lower temperature setting.
Warning: If anyone in your household is immunocompromised or you have a large plumbing system with long pipe runs, consult the water heater manufacturer's documentation or a plumber before lowering below 120 degrees. Legionella bacteria can grow at temperatures below that threshold in certain conditions.
2

Seal air leaks around doors and windows

Hold a lit stick of incense or a thin piece of tissue near door frames, window edges, and electrical outlets on exterior walls. Movement in the smoke or tissue indicates air infiltration. Apply self-adhesive foam weatherstripping to door frames and V-strip (tension seal) weatherstripping to window sashes where gaps appear. For electrical outlets on exterior walls, install foam gaskets behind the outlet covers.

Door sweeps on the base of exterior doors address the gap at floor level, which is often one of the largest single sources of air leakage in older homes.

Tip: Weatherstripping and foam gaskets are widely available at hardware stores and typically cost only a few dollars per door or window. The materials pay for themselves in one or two heating seasons.
3

Set a thermostat schedule and stick to it

Heating and cooling account for the largest portion of most home energy bills. Setting your thermostat 7 to 10 degrees lower (in winter) or higher (in summer) for the 8 or more hours a day when the house is empty or everyone is asleep can reduce annual heating and cooling costs by around 10 percent, according to the U.S. Department of Energy. Program this into your existing thermostat using its built-in schedule function, or set a phone reminder to adjust it manually if your thermostat lacks programming.

Warning: In winter, do not set the thermostat below 55 degrees Fahrenheit when the home is unoccupied for extended periods. Pipes in exterior walls can freeze at low indoor temperatures.
4

Shift large appliance use to off-peak hours

If your utility offers time-of-use pricing, running the dishwasher, washing machine, and clothes dryer after 9 p.m. or before 7 a.m. can meaningfully reduce the per-kilowatt-hour rate you pay. Check your utility bill or provider's website to see whether time-of-use rates apply to your account. Even without time-of-use pricing, running these appliances with full loads rather than partial ones improves energy and water efficiency per unit of laundry or dishes cleaned.

Tip: Most modern dishwashers and washing machines have a delay-start feature. Setting a delay allows you to load the appliance in the evening and have it run automatically during low-rate hours overnight.
5

Fix dripping faucets and running toilets

A faucet dripping at one drop per second wastes roughly 3,000 gallons per year, according to the U.S. Environmental Protection Agency. A running toilet can waste 200 gallons or more per day. Replace worn faucet washers or cartridges using the repair kit designed for your faucet type (check the brand and model stamped on the faucet body). For a running toilet, the most common cause is a worn flapper valve, which costs about $5 to $10 and takes under 15 minutes to replace without special tools.

Tip: To confirm a toilet is running silently, add a few drops of food coloring to the tank. If color appears in the bowl within 15 minutes without flushing, the flapper is not sealing properly.
6

Eliminate phantom (standby) power loads

Electronics and appliances draw power even when switched off or in standby mode. Televisions, game consoles, cable boxes, and older phone chargers are common contributors. Plug home entertainment equipment into a power strip with an on/off switch and turn the strip off when the equipment is not in use. For devices that genuinely need to stay in standby (such as a cable DVR scheduled to record), leave those plugged in directly. The goal is to cut phantom load from devices that offer no benefit while drawing power in standby.

Keeping gains over time

One-time fixes help, but the real savings come from repeating a few checks regularly. Once a year, inspect weatherstripping for wear, check that HVAC filters are replaced on schedule (typically every 1 to 3 months depending on filter type and household), and review your utility bills against the same month the prior year. A sudden spike usually signals a new leak, a failing appliance seal, or a change in household behavior worth examining.
